Understanding Treadmill Energy Costs in Oakland, CA

Oakland is a mid-sized California city where residential electricity rates from Pacific Gas & Electric (PG&E) are shaped by regional energy supply and local demand patterns. Running a moderate-draw appliance like the Treadmill (1,500W) at Oakland's rate of 27.9¢/kWh costs approximately $42 per year — $22 more than the national average of $20.

Electricity in Oakland is significantly more expensive than the national average — 115% higher. For a Treadmill used 0.5 hours per day, this rate premium adds up to $22 in extra annual costs. Energy-efficient models and usage habits have an outsized impact in high-rate markets like this.
